Just wondering if any one has ordered the new
Generation f.....r/ set,=NGF put out by Bob Swadling and Mark Msaon? And what are tour thoughts on it. I have just received my walking liberty set and love it. The coins that came with the set have been Fitted beautifully And have been working flawlessy I must say that I was a bit skeptical at the price for somethong that I already had from another Great craftsman ( no names) But I am very happy with the High standards that Bob Swadling and Mark Mason have put into this set. Very smooth and have a nice Feel and YES I have tried to break it (Fl....r--NGF) and it is very strong with no sighns of letting go any time soon. The set comes with a few extras that can be seen at Mark Masons website Thanks Sal PS: Hope some others have some Ideas on routines with this set Read there was a thread on just this but I cannot Find it through then search -- Any help on where it might be would be great. |

bowers Inner circle Oakboro N.C. 7024 Posts |
I have the ngf by mark mason and
bob swaldling.very nice indeed. I had quit using flippers because the constant upkeep on them.and sometimes going bad during a performence.but the ngf solved all that for me.and the quick fix if it ever breaks.is great too.but I have yet to break it. todd |
emyers99 Inner circle Columbus, Ohio 4748 Posts |
I love my set. Very well made and flipper being nearly unbreakable was a great selling point. The pocket gimmick that comes with the set is a great touch. Allows you to reach in pocket and immediately come out ready to produce three coins.

baobow Special user 510 Posts |
At blackpool I asked Mark Mason if he could supply coins with a milled edge. He stated that Bob Swadling could do it at an additional cost. He mention 20 pounds or something extra 9 don't quote me on the price) to provide the milling. Might be worth getting in touch with Mark or Bob
